About
M-KOPA Solar: M-KOPA
Solar, head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ya, is the global leader of
"pay-as-you-go" energy for off-grid customers.
Since
its commercial launch in October 2012, M-KOPA has connected more than 350,000
homes in Kenya, Tanzania and Uganda to solar power, and is now adding over 500
new homes each day.
Customers
acquire solar systems for a small deposit and then purchase daily usage
"credits" for Kshs 50, or less than the price of traditional kerosene
lighting. After one year of payments customers own their solar systems
outright and can upgrade to more power.
All
revenues are collected in real-time via mobile money systems (such as M-PESA in
Kenya) and embedded GSM sensors in each solar system allow M-KOPA to monitor
real time performance and regulate usage based upon payments.
This
connected design means that M-KOPA is processing vast amounts of data (i.e.
over 10,000 mobile payments per day) via the company's proprietary cloud
platform, M-KOPAnet.
As of
January 2016 M-KOPA employs over 700 full time staff across East Africa and
sells through a network of over 1,000 direct sales agents. It has also
commenced licensing its technology to partners in other markets.
M-KOPA
has been recognised for its pioneering business mode and scale, notably winning
the 2015 Zayed Future Energy Prize, being selected as the top New Energy
Pioneer at the 2014 Bloomberg New Energy Finance awards and earning the 2013
FT/IFC Excellence in Sustainable Finance Award.
M-KOPA has also successfully tested a range of new products that leverage its relationship with customers, and M-KOPA’s unique competencies in mobile telecommunications and ICT.
To
ensure that the research and development of new products add value to (and do
not distract from) its core business, M-KOPA is establishing the M-KOPA
Labs.
The
Labs will be a dedicated business unit within M-KOPA that will define and test
extensions of the M-KOPA asset-based credit model for off-grid-power to new
products and services.
